讲座简介: Soil organic matter (SOM) contains about twice the amount of carbon in the atmosphere and is an important component in global carbon cycle and terrestrial ecosystem. With global changes,potential shifts in SOM degradation and transport are a major concern. Yet due to its heterogeneity, SOM remains largely unknown in terms of its molecular composition and responses to climatic events. My research focuses on the degradation and transport of SOM in terrestrial and riverine systems and on the biogeochemical and physical processes that affect organic matter distribution atboth the molecular level and landscape scales.In particular, using molecular-level techniques [including biomarkers,nuclear magnetic resonance (NMR) spectrometry and compound-specific 14C analyses], I hope to utilize the structural and isotopic information preserved in soil organic molecules and provide novel insights into soil carbon dynamics in a changing climate. My talk will focus on the following aspects: (1) Changes in SOM composition and soil carbon processes under climate changes (including warming and CO2 enrichment, etc); (2) Environmental controls on the residence time of land-derived carbon during global river transports (a compound-specific 14C perspective); (3) Climate-induced mobilization of permafrost carbon in the Arctic. |
